Public bug reported: I have two displays and have Night Light mode enabled with Sunset to Sunrise setting (tried to change it into Manual, but this didn't make any difference).
It was perfectly OK some time before, but now only display #2 is started with the Night Light mode switched on. I can work around it: go to the Display Settings, try to switch into non-native mode for Display #1 and it switched into it with Night Light enabled. Then choose not to keep settings and it returns into native resolution with Night Light on. Not all changes help to switch the mode on though. For instance, mirroring screen doesn't switch it on.
